Peru: Fugitive ex-governor Felix Moreno caught by police

10:17 | Lima, Nov. 12.

National Police of Peru arrested former Callao Region Governor Felix Moreno Monday night in Cieneguilla, Lima.

As confirmed by the Interior Ministry, the detention was made as a result of a patient work of the Anti-Kidnapping Unit of the Directorate of Criminal Investigation (Dirincri) within the National Police, in coordination with the General Directorate of Intelligence (Digimin) within the Interior Ministry.

Interior Minister Carlos Moran claimed that Moreno was captured at 11:40 PM along with a woman named Sheila Reyes Vasquez. 

According to Moran, the former regional authority had cash in his possession.

Moreno had been a fugitive since January this year, when the Judiciary sentenced him to five years of effective imprisonment.

Authorities had issued an arrest warrant against him for the Corpac case and the undervalued sale of a property in Oquendo Estate.

In addition, he is investigated for allegedly receiving US$2.4 million from Brazilian construction company Odebrecht as a bribe to get the Costa Verde del Callao concession.

This is the second most important capture of a fugitive in less than fifteen days, following that of former lawmaker Edwin Donayre, who was arrested on October 30, after several months as a fugitive.
